From c52cae4e44c0b53ece5f3bd55cb6777239223cdb Mon Sep 17 00:00:00 2001 From: Michael Taylor Date: Sun, 3 Nov 2002 19:51:10 +0000 Subject: used PF_PACKET for SOCK_PACKET sockets, added time.h to axspawn.c --- ax25/axspawn.c | 3 ++- ax25/mheardd.c | 2 +- ax25/rxecho.c | 2 +- 3 files changed, 4 insertions(+), 3 deletions(-) (limited to 'ax25') diff --git a/ax25/axspawn.c b/ax25/axspawn.c index ab5ab92..6c63fde 100644 --- a/ax25/axspawn.c +++ b/ax25/axspawn.c @@ -1,6 +1,6 @@ /* * - * $Id: axspawn.c,v 1.6 1996/08/24 22:33:05 jreuter Exp jreuter $ + * $Id: axspawn.c,v 1.2 2002/11/03 19:51:10 mctaylor Exp $ * * axspawn.c - run a program from ax25d. * @@ -125,6 +125,7 @@ #include #include #include +#include #include #include #include diff --git a/ax25/mheardd.c b/ax25/mheardd.c index f1a6aab..d0aab98 100644 --- a/ax25/mheardd.c +++ b/ax25/mheardd.c @@ -182,7 +182,7 @@ int main(int argc, char **argv) fclose(fp); } - if ((s = socket(AF_INET, SOCK_PACKET, htons(ETH_P_AX25))) == -1) { + if ((s = socket(PF_PACKET, SOCK_PACKET, htons(ETH_P_AX25))) == -1) { perror("mheardd: socket"); return 1; } diff --git a/ax25/rxecho.c b/ax25/rxecho.c index 0dd601f..a9f9a64 100644 --- a/ax25/rxecho.c +++ b/ax25/rxecho.c @@ -350,7 +350,7 @@ int main(int argc, char **argv) if ((list = readconfig()) == NULL) return 1; - if ((s = socket(AF_INET, SOCK_PACKET, htons(ETH_P_AX25))) == -1) { + if ((s = socket(PF_PACKET, SOCK_PACKET, htons(ETH_P_AX25))) == -1) { perror("rxecho: socket:"); return 1; } -- cgit v1.2.3